- [x] Step 4: Implement the shared recursive copier
Create scripts/docs/project_assets.py:
from __future__ import annotations
import shutil
from pathlib import Path
def copy_project_assets(repo_root: Path, out_dir: Path, expected: set[Path]) -> list[Path]:
source_root = repo_root / "docs/assets"
if not source_root.exists():
return []
written: list[Path] = []
for source in sorted(path for path in source_root.rglob("*") if path.is_file()):
destination = out_dir / "assets" / source.relative_to(source_root)
destination.parent.mkdir(parents=True, exist_ok=True)
shutil.copy2(source, destination)
expected.add(destination)
written.append(destination)
return written
Import and call it in both renderers before their stale-file sweeps:
from scripts.docs.project_assets import copy_project_assets
copy_project_assets(repo_root, out_dir, expected)
